## Summary
Sułkowice is a city located in southern Poland within the European continent. It serves as the administrative capital of Gmina Sułkowice, covering an area of 16.46 square kilometers. According to the 2021 Polish census, the city has a total population of 6,542 residents.

### Geography and Location
Sułkowice is positioned in Europe within the boundaries of Poland. The city's geographic coordinates are recorded at two precise sets of points: 49.8377°N, 19.7955°E and 49.8405°N, 19.8009°E. The city encompasses a total land area of 16.46 square kilometers. Sułkowice falls within the postal code region 32-440.

### Demographics and Population
According to the Polish census of 2021, confirmed on March 31 of that year, Sułkowice has a population of 6,542 inhabitants. The population data reveals a gender distribution of 3,180 males and 3,362 females. This data was sourced from the Statistics Poland (bdl.stat.gov.pl) API.
